24 Apartments Forced To Evacuate In Lakeland Fire

LAKELAND, FL -- A stubborn fire raged for more than three hours at the Arbor Glen Apartments Monday, prompting the evacuation of a number of residents, according to the Lakeland Fire Department.
The agency's Janel Vasallo said the blaze displaced all of the residents of the apartment building's 24 units. The complex is located at 4950 Deep Forest Court in Lakeland.
"Upon arriving, crews began evacuating residents, including the use of forceful entry into apartment units to ensure the safe evacuation of all residents," she explained. "Upon successfully evacuating residents, crew began the search for the source of the smoke and found fire in the attic on the south-side of the building."

The attic where the fire broke out was on a third floor of the building.
"The fire quickly spread through the attic of the structure and the nature of the blaze intensified, which led to a defensive attack in attempts to control the blaze," explained Vasallo. "An aerial water supply was provided from Tower 15, Engine 61, and Engine 71, which surrounded the building as well as master streams from the ground level."

The fire broke out around 5:30 p.m. and was contained around 8:45 p.m. Firefighters later reentered the structure to eliminate remaining hot spots and search for pets.
Arbor Glen apartments, which is owned by Greystone Property, has been working with residents to contact insurers and find other accommodations.
The American Red Cross was also helping displaced residents. The Lakeland Fire Department received emergency assistance from Polk County Fire Rescue under a mutual aid agreement.

No injuries were reported.
